Solar Panel Clamp Torque Specs: The Right Number for M8 Bolts (and When It’s Different)

If you’re holding a torque wrench right now, here’s the number: most solar module clamps use M8 bolts torqued somewhere between 6 and 20 Nm, with 14-20 Nm being the range you’ll see most often across manufacturer manuals. That’s roughly 5-15 ft-lb if your wrench reads in imperial units. Now the part that actually matters.
